Biostatistician Salary in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ania

The median biostatistician salary in Philadelphia, PA is $96,900 per year, which is 2.0% above the national median and 6.3% above the Pennsylvania state average.

Biostatistician Salary in Philadelphia by Experience

In Philadelphia, an entry-level biostatistician earns around $63,240, while experienced professionals earn up to $150,960 per year. The local cost of living index is 102% of the national average.

Job Outlook

Nationally, biostatistician employment is projected to grow 30% over the next decade (much faster than average). Demand in Philadelphia may vary based on local industry and population growth.
